Scotland Under-19 squad confirmed for friendlies in Belgium

International Friendly Belgium v Scotland Sporting Hasselt, Hasselt Wednesday, 6 September (3pm kick off - UK time)

International Friendly Scotland v Czech Republic Sporting Hasselt, Hasselt Saturday, 9 September (1pm kick off - UK time)

Scotland Under-19s return to action next month with a trip to Belgium for two friendly matches.

Billy Stark's side will face Belgium in Hasselt on Wednesday, 6 September before taking on Czech Republic three days later at the same venue.

The Under-19s were last in action in March, when they took on Wales in a double header.

These two games will allow Stark to assess his squad ahead of the UEFA Euro 2024 Qualifying Round which takes place in November.

Scotland have been drawn alongside Serbia, Bulgaria and Andorra for those qualifiers.

The group contains a mixture of players who featured in Wales while there are a number of new faces, with seven moving up from the Under-17 side who competed at the UEFA Euro 2023 finals in Hungary in May.
